The Enterprise Efficiency Leak

When you operate multiple brands or divisions independently, you multiply your overhead. Your BUs are likely bidding against each other in Google Ads, paying for redundant software subscriptions, and failing to share high-value customer data.

Internal Cannibalization

Brand A and Brand B are targeting the exact same audience on Meta. They are driving up each other's CPMs and competing for the same dollar.

Data Isolation

A VIP customer of your apparel division has never heard of your footwear division because your email lists and CRMs do not communicate.

Rigid Budgeting

BU #1 has exhausted its profitable audience but still has budget. BU #2 is starved for cash but has 5x ROAS. Budgets must be fluid, not fixed.

Executive FAQs

How do we prevent cannibalization between our own BUs?

We consolidate your ad accounts into a single master Business Manager. We set up cross-exclusions (negative audience lists) so Brand A's ads are never served to Brand B's core demographic unless specifically designed as a cross-sell campaign.

Can we maintain distinct brand voices?

Absolutely. Centralizing operations does not mean homogenization of creative. We utilize dedicated brand managers for the front-end creative (copy, visuals, tone) while centralizing the back-end (data, media buying, infrastructure) to gain economies of scale.

How is budget shifting managed practically?

We establish an "Enterprise Marketing Fund" rather than rigid, isolated BU budgets. Using real-time LTV:CAC ratios, we implement logic that automatically routes daily ad spend to the division currently experiencing the highest conversion rates, maximizing total portfolio yield.
